Define Reserve & Provision?
Answer Posted / vellingiri
Reserve:
Reserve is created out of the profit of a company for the
purpose of distribution of divident and redemption of
shares/debentures etc.
Provision;
Provision is created for a particular purpose for
example income tax provision. So that particular provision
can be utilized for that particular purpose.
